Hotel CommonwealthvsThe Eliot Hotel
Hotel Commonwealth and Eliot Hotel are both highly recommended by writers. Overall, Eliot Hotel scores marginally better than Hotel Commonwealth. Eliot Hotel scores 87 with approval from 16 reviews like The Telegraph, Condé Nast Traveler and Hideaway Report.
